Tribal Banditry in Ottoman Ayntab (1690-1730)Soyudoğan, Muhsin.M.A., Department of History.Supervisior: Asst. Prof. Oktay Özel.This thesis attempts to understand the tribal banditry through a micro historicalanalsysis, which focuses on the tribal banditry in Ayntab region during the lateseveneteenth and early eighteenth century. Though it focuses on a specific region, ittries to contribute to the discussion on banditry and also tries to develop a model foranalyzing banditry in the Ottoman Empire. The novelty of this model is that it ismore likely to consider different factors, like social organization, which is mainlyshaped by the group perception of the actor, and social, economical, and politicalmotivators, in understanding banditry. Moreover, this study offers an approach thatsees the banditry as not sporadic events but a long lasting phenomenon in theOttoman history. Thus, it reflects banditry as embodied socio-political conflicts.Key Words: Tribes, social and political banditry, social power, social organization,kinship system, Ayntab, the Otoman Empire.iii
